python怎么給各語句添加注釋
Python注釋、代碼可讀性、代碼維護性編程技巧注釋是在編程過程中向代碼添加解釋、說明和備注的文本信息,它不會被解釋器執(zhí)行。在Python中,我們可以使用不同的方法來給各語句添加注釋。1. 單行注釋單
Python注釋、代碼可讀性、代碼維護性
編程技巧
注釋是在編程過程中向代碼添加解釋、說明和備注的文本信息,它不會被解釋器執(zhí)行。在Python中,我們可以使用不同的方法來給各語句添加注釋。
1. 單行注釋
單行注釋以井號“#”開頭,可以用于解釋單個語句或行內(nèi)注釋。
示例代碼:
```
# 這是一個單行注釋
x 1 # 初始化變量x為1
```
2. 多行注釋
多行注釋可以用三對引號(單引號或雙引號)包含起來,可以用于解釋多個語句或塊注釋。
示例代碼:
```
"""
這是一個多行注釋
可以跨越多行
"""
x 1
y 2
'''
這也是一個多行注釋
可以使用單引號
'''
z x y
```
3. 函數(shù)/方法注釋
Python的函數(shù)和方法可以使用文檔字符串(Docstring)來進行注釋,用于說明函數(shù)的功能、參數(shù)、返回值等相關(guān)信息。
示例代碼:
```python
def add(x, y):
"""
這是一個加法函數(shù)
參數(shù):x,y為兩個相加的數(shù)
返回值:相加后的結(jié)果
"""
return x y
```
在使用函數(shù)或方法時,可以通過調(diào)用`help()`函數(shù)來查看文檔字符串的內(nèi)容。
4. 類注釋
與函數(shù)/方法注釋類似,Python的類也可以使用文檔字符串進行注釋,用于說明類的功能、屬性、方法等相關(guān)信息。
示例代碼:
```python
class Calculator:
"""
這是一個計算器類
提供了加法、減法、乘法、除法等方法
"""
def add(self, x, y):
"""
加法
參數(shù):x,y為相加的兩個數(shù)
返回值:相加后的結(jié)果
"""
return x y
def subtract(self, x, y):
"""
減法
參數(shù):x,y為相減的兩個數(shù)
返回值:相減后的結(jié)果
"""
return x - y
```
在使用類時,同樣可以通過`help()`函數(shù)查看文檔字符串的內(nèi)容。
總結(jié):
通過給Python語句添加注釋,我們可以提高代碼的可讀性和可維護性。合理地使用單行注釋、多行注釋、函數(shù)/方法注釋和類注釋,可以讓他人更容易理解代碼的意圖和邏輯。同時,在編寫注釋時,應(yīng)盡量保持簡潔明了、準(zhǔn)確一致的風(fēng)格,為代碼的閱讀和維護提供便利。